From age-old ghost stories to chilling tales from the spirit realm, the Japanese Film Festival (JFF) presents a free Classics program featuring spine-tingling horror from 21 September to 26 November. Titled Grief and Vengeance: Otherworldly Tales in Sydney, with abridged versions in Melbourne and Canberra, the program features landmark films from Japanese horror pioneer Nobuo Nakagawa, alongside contemporaries Masaki Kobayashi and Satsuo Yamamoto.

2019 Japanese Film Festival Classics films featured in Canberra include:

- The Ghost Story of Yotsuya
- Black Cat Mansion
- The Living Koheiji
- The Adventures of Tobisuke
